Simulation-Based Validation

Developers should learn and use Simulation-Based Validation when building safety-critical systems, IoT applications, or systems with high operational costs, as it reduces risks and costs associated with physical testing

Pros

  • +It is particularly valuable in domains like robotics, healthcare simulations, and financial modeling, where real-world testing is impractical, dangerous, or expensive, enabling iterative testing and validation in controlled virtual environments
